VAC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2014 in Review
238 of the 3,749 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Marriott Vacations Worldwide (VAC) for Q4 2014, worth a combined $1.71B — up 14% from $1.5B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new VAC positions and 14 closed out — a net gain of 26 holders — while 52 added to existing stakes and 93 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Victory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$36.5M. The largest seller was GRS Advisors, exiting entirely with an estimated $44.4M sold.
